Transaction 64e1ecbe60c753793359e1d28ce2a047eae5c88008a9411d0efbe43857265476

1 Input
2 Outputs
  • 64e1ecbe60c753793359e1d28ce2a047eae5c88008a9411d0efbe43857265476:0
  • value  36897606
    address  2Mtyqeam6yeZzTBnuMkonwMvEgdAvt3jzwf
  • 64e1ecbe60c753793359e1d28ce2a047eae5c88008a9411d0efbe43857265476:1
  • value  100000
    address  2MsnWgAPMvJqNbXfdhNT5r4EWBmA4kefxiU